Java开发自评:具备良好的编码习惯吗?

作为一名Java开发者,编码习惯的养成对于保证代码质量、提高开发效率至关重要。本文将从以下几个方面对个人在Java开发过程中的编码习惯进行自评,探讨如何养成良好的编码习惯。

一、代码规范性

  1. 命名规范:遵循驼峰命名法,变量、方法名以小写字母开头,类名以大写字母开头。例如:userListlogin()User

  2. 缩进与空白:使用4个空格进行缩进,保持代码整齐,提高可读性。

  3. 注释:合理添加注释,解释代码的功能、实现原理和注意事项,便于他人阅读和维护。

  4. 代码格式:使用IDE进行代码格式化,确保代码风格统一。

二、代码可读性

  1. 模块化:将功能划分为独立的模块,提高代码复用性。

  2. 复用性:尽量使用现有库和框架,避免重复造轮子。

  3. 异常处理:合理使用异常处理机制,提高代码健壮性。

  4. 日志记录:添加日志记录,便于问题追踪和调试。

三、代码质量

  1. 单元测试:编写单元测试,确保代码功能正确,提高代码质量。

  2. 性能优化:关注代码性能,进行优化,提高系统响应速度。

  3. 代码审查:积极参与代码审查,学习他人优点,提高自身代码质量。

  4. 重构:定期对代码进行重构,提高代码可读性和可维护性。

案例分析

以下是一个关于命名规范的案例分析:

不规范

String a = "Hello";
int b = 1;
int c = 2;
System.out.println(a + b + c);

规范

String userName = "Hello";
int firstNumber = 1;
int secondNumber = 2;
System.out.println(userName + firstNumber + secondNumber);

从上述案例可以看出,规范的命名可以使代码更加清晰易懂,便于他人阅读和维护。

四、团队协作

  1. 沟通与协作:与团队成员保持良好沟通,共同解决问题。

  2. 代码规范统一:遵循团队代码规范,确保代码风格统一。

  3. 代码审查:积极参与代码审查,为团队提供有益的建议。

  4. 技术分享:定期进行技术分享,提高团队整体技术水平。

五、持续学习

  1. 关注新技术:关注Java技术发展,学习新技术、新框架。

  2. 阅读源码:阅读优秀开源项目的源码,学习优秀的设计和实现方式。

  3. 参加培训:参加相关培训,提高自身技术能力。

  4. 实践与总结:在实践中不断总结经验,提高解决问题的能力。

总之,作为一名Java开发者,养成良好的编码习惯对于提高自身技术水平、保证代码质量、提高开发效率具有重要意义。在今后的工作中,我将继续努力,不断提高自己的编码水平,为团队和公司创造更多价值。

猜你喜欢:猎头网